What does it mean when flowers are blooming?

The flowers are the showy part of a plant. When the flowers are showing the plant is said to be blooming. This bloom is to attract insects for pollination.

What is a blooming plant?

A blooming plant is a plant that produces flowers. These flowers can range in size, shape, and color, and they are often used for reproduction. Blooming plants are found in various environments and can be grown in gardens or as indoor houseplants.

How do you deadhead daylilies to promote continuous blooming?

To promote continuous blooming of daylilies, you can deadhead them by removing the faded flowers. This encourages the plant to produce more blooms and prolongs the blooming period.
